We got the PowerEdge III Boxes a month ago.
http://mywiki.ncsa.uiuc.edu/wiki/Dell_PE1950_NIC_Firmware_Workaround is the solution I found. However I did not have any CD with me, so I tried to upgrade the NIC driver first as indicated by the following link in Citrix forum
http://forums.citrix.com/thread.jspa?threadID=151786&tstart=0

I worked for me, but some guys in Citrix forum said it still has some problems after one week running.

I am still testing it, and let you know if it solves the problem or just hides it.
